Paul and Polly Doughty Research Endowment
Paul and Polly Doughty established this endowment in 2001.
Paul Doughty is a University of Florida distinguished service professor emeritus. His research includes cultural anthropology, peace studies, applied anthropology and Latin American studies. Polly Doughty is a local activist and an avid supporter of women’s studies at UF.
